About Atarhai

Atarhai is a rural settlement in Pawai, Panna, Madhya Pradesh. It has a population of 1,108 in about 290 households (avg size: 3.82). Approximate literacy: 49.19%.

Population of Atarhai

Population (Total)1,108
Male596
Female512
Children (0–6 years)154
Households290
Literate persons545
Illiterate persons563
Total workers326
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)859
Literacy (approx.)49.19%
SC population231
ST population0
